The Brooklyn Museum's decorative arts collection is housed on the fourth floor of the Museum. The focus of the collection is a group of twenty-three American period rooms ranging in date from the seventeenth century to the twentieth century. Interspersed with the period rooms are galleries that display an outstanding collection of American and European decorative arts.
